This advanced n8n workflow leverages multi-agent orchestration with the new AI Tool Node to create complete AI-generated books from a simple chat trigger. Starting with a user prompt, the Book Brief Agent crafts title, subtitle, and outline. The Book Writer Agent then collaborates with Designer and Content Writer sub-agents to produce full chapters, while DALL-E generates a custom cover image uploaded to AWS S3.

How to import this workflow into n8n
- 1Purchase or download the workflow to get the n8n workflow JSON file.
- 2In your n8n instance, open Workflows and choose "Import from File" (or paste the JSON with Ctrl+V on the canvas).
- 3Open each node marked with a credential warning and connect your own accounts and API keys.
- 4Run the workflow once manually to verify the data flow, then toggle it to Active.
